UNO!

Who is up for a game of Uno?? Or who is up for collecting the cards?

Yes, Uno has not only became a classic game but also has what I call collectible cards now.

With more than 2000 cards to collect, there is a lot to chase.

Before, I show off some, I need to chase down my first cup of coffee today first.

*takes a sip*

I ended up finding one of these "packs" to open for fun by the gaming section in Walmart. No, not the video game section, these things called board games that once existed.

These "packs" cost $5 and comes with 56 random cards plus 4 cool looking foil cards.
 
Breakdown on the back.

I never looked into how to play this version of Uno as I wanted to collect them, but I am sure it's fun. Will it be as fun as the original game? Probably not. I haven't found one spinoff of a good board game to be worthy of its original.

Here is a peek at the cards,
They feature the game play, a die-cut kind of thing and a player photo.




I believe that each of these cards for every player has a different colored border variation as well. Which is why the checklist is so big. What the different colors mean, I don't know.

But what I do know is that the foil ones are completely fire.



 
I believe these are the "valuable" cards to chase in the set. I just like them because they look really nice, and I want to see if I can chase some of the Giants now to.
